Caney

Ruby Wicker
Published Wednesday, April 15, 1998 in the Nevada County Picayune

Safrona Stokes of Mountain Home is visiting Junior and Ann Loe for a few days. They all had lunch with Sam and Jane Bradshaw in Camden Sunday after church. Ann is going back to Mountain Home to spend a week with Safrona.

Having lunch with J.W. and Maxine Glass Sunday were Jackie, Kathy, Abby and Heath Glass of Magnolia, Stacy Story of Stephens, Liz Nunn, Shauntelle Bennett of Hope, Tracy Bennett, Karen, Hoyt, Jason and Sarah Jobe of Prescott, Bach Morton, Kim Overton, Tom Cornelius of Prescott, and Pam, Kevin, Clancy and Hannah Cleveland of Emmet. They all had an Easter egg hunt after lunch. Pat and Tim McCullough came by for the egg hunt. Steve Wicker also came by and showed some movies of the early years of the Glass families.

We had a very good worship service Sunday. We were thrilled to have three new first times in our church babies in service Sunday.

Kevin Karmel and family of Dallas, Texas, visited his parents, Ken and Arlis, for the weekend. They brought their twin babies to church.

Betty McBride is scheduled for knee surgery this week.

Coy and Grace Callicott are back home and are feeling better.

Linda Glass, who lives in Louisiana and has many relatives in Caney, is celebrating her 100th birthday this week.

Lucy Glass and Sidney Steed visited Ethel Ellis and her husband in Sutton Sunday afternoon.

Amy, Chris and Emily Sweat went to church with me Sunday and we all went to Phyllis Stewart's and her family for lunch.

Cannon and Heather had lunch with her grandparents, Johnny and Huey Shewbirt, Sunday.

Don, Janice and Robert Callicott had lunch with Pocket and Nez Sunday.

Double 'C' Extension Home-makers Club will meet Wednesday evening at 6:30 at Cale City Hall.

Bro. Tal Webb will be in revival in Coushatta, La., this week. Pray for his safety as he travels back and forth.

We will have our regular Bible study Thursday evening at 7:00. We are still viewing tapes on creation versus evolution. You all come.
